Step 9: Enable offline mode for the Fieldmark survey app before promoting the build. Verify the local sync queue persists across app restarts and that conflict resolution prefers the newest server record. Reviewers should confirm the offline manifest lists every form schema bundled with the release; a missing schema silently breaks data entry in disconnected regions. Once the manifest checks out, the build must be signed for distribution. The signing key for this release is below.

rollout seal: bky9_PeXH1fTLY

Export Retry Basics (Larkspool Support)

When a customer reports a failed export, you can retry it yourself from the Larkspool admin console without escalating. Open the export record, click Retry, and watch for the green confirmation banner. If the retry tool itself errors out, check that your local env file is set up; it must contain the admin retry key on its own line.

vault entry, kagep-yajeg: COURIER_KEY5=da097

**Ticket: Config drift on BounceSift processor**

The email bounce processor in the Larkfield environment has drifted from the values committed in the release branch. Retry windows and suppression thresholds no longer match, which likely explains the duplicate suppression entries reported Tuesday. Please reconcile before the Thursday cut. For reference, the currently deployed configuration on the live node reads as follows.

config for yajep-yahof:
[briax]
port = 9200
region = outer-2
host = briax.nelvrocorp.test
team = raleth
timeout_ms = 1500
retries = 1